Linas Klimavičius (born 10 April 1989) is a Lithuanian professional footballer who plays as a defender for Panevėžys and the Lithuania national team.

Career

Klimavičius started his career as a teenage prodigy with Ekranas and then was promoted to the main-squad team. During 2008–2012, he played in the Ukrainian football clubs.[1] He made a single appearance in the Ukrainian Premier League in a match for FC Dnipro against Metalurh Donetsk on 19 October 2008.[2]

Dinamo București

In January 2019, Klimavičius signed a contract with Liga I club Dinamo București.[3] One year later, in January 2020, he was released after 28 games played for Dinamo (27 in Liga I and one game in Cupa României).[4]

Politehnica Iasi

On 12 January 2020, Klimavičius signed a contract with Liga I club FC Politehnica Iași.[5]

FK Sūduva

In 10 September he signed a contract with Lithuanian champions FK Sūduva.[6]
